Hedge Fund Desk Assistant/ PA Full-time

at Cutting Hedge Recruitment in London (Published at 29-02-2012)

Our client is a leading multi billion dollar global hedge fund based in the West End. They are currently looking to hire a candidate who will provide competent and proactive support to the fund desk.

Job description

• Provide proactive and effective support to the CIO and other members of the fund desk. This involves dealing with diary management, updating contacts, processing expense claims, holiday monitoring and arranging complex overseas travel and itineraries
• As the CIO travels extensively, the successful candidate will be required to show initiative with travel planning
• Scheduling of internal and external meetings ensuring all paperwork and briefing documents are available prior to meetings
• Take minutes and actions for the desk meetings. Over time the successful candidate will be expected to develop an understanding of what the team does and what they are talking about
• Prepare and update presentations through PowerPoint, pulling data from various services such as Bloomberg and the Internet
• Regularly maintaining and distributing research to desk members
• Undertake ad-hoc projects as directed from members of the team
• In time, as the successful candidate’s knowledge of the team and fund grows, there is scope for this role to grow too.
